So today was another great day in New York City. This morning a group of us went to the tenement housing museum which fascinated me. It was quite the experience to see what life was like for immigrants in the late 1800s to early 1900s. Each apartment was very small. I would say that my bedroom and bathroom combined would be about the same size as an apartment that was known to house up to 15 people. Lighting was terrible. One entire floor, or 4 apartments shared one toilet. I wish I had pictures of it, but they would not allow photography.
